Giter VIP home page Giter VIP logo

matbeich / phimpme-ios Goto Github PK

View Code? Open in Web Editor NEW

This project forked from jogendra/phimpme-ios

0.0 2.0 0.0 47.82 MB

Phimp.me - Photo Image Editor and Sharing App. Phimp.me is a Photo App for iOS that aims to replace proprietary photo applications. It offers features such as taking photos, adding filters, editing images and uploading them to social networks.

License: MIT License

Swift 99.33% Ruby 0.67%

phimpme-ios's Introduction

Phimp.me iOS

Phimp.me is a Photo App for iOS that aims to replace proprietary photo applications. It offers features such as taking photos, adding filters, editing images and uploading them to social networks.


Features

  • Click beautiful images using the Phimp.me app. Use various advanced scene modes and variety of balance modes.

  • Use your voice actions to invoke Camera, Just say "Hey Siri click a picture". You can also select front and rear camera based on voice.

  • Browse the local gallery inside the app with folder and all photos mode. Copy, move and add a description to the images.

  • Edit images with various cool filters with optimized performance, built using GPUImage framework.

  • Enhance contrast, hue, satur, temp, tint, and sharpness of the image.

  • Use 'Crop and rotate' features from Transform section to get your perfect image.

  • Apply different stickers - facial, express, objects, comments, wishes, emojis, hashtag.

  • Write anything on the images in your handwriting!.

  • Easily go back and forth with 'redo' and 'undo'.

  • Finally, after all this editing you can easily share the image to your favourite social media sites with our easy-to-use sharing feature.

  • Facebook, Twitter, NextCloud, OwnCloud, Imgur, Dropbox, Box, Flickr, Pinterest, Instagram, Whatsapp, and Tumblr - You name it and we have it covered.


Setting up the iOS Project

  1. Clone the repo
$ git clone https://github.com/imjog/phimpme-iOS.git
  1. Navigate to the project folder
$ cd phimpme-iOS
  1. Open Phimpme.xcodeproj from the folder.

  2. Build the project (โŒ˜+B) and check for any errors.

  3. Run the app (โŒ˜+R).and test it.

Screenshots

Following design is using for app development:

Branch Policy

Note: For the initialization period all commits go directly to the master branch. In the next stages we follow the branch policy as below:

We have the following branches

  • ipa - All the automatic builds generates, i.e., the ipas go into this branch
  • master - This contains the stable code. After significant features/bugfixes are accumulated on development, we move it to master.
  • development - All development goes on in this branch. If you're making a contribution, you are supposed to make a pull request to development.

Code practices

Please help us follow the best practice to make it easy for the reviewer as well as the contributor. We want to focus on the code quality more than on managing pull request ethics.

  • Single commit per pull request
  • For writing commit messages please read the COMMITSTYLE carefully. Kindly adhere to the guidelines.
  • Follow uniform design practices. The design language must be consistent throughout the app.
  • The pull request will not get merged until and unless the commits are squashed. In case there are multiple commits on the PR, the commit author needs to squash them and not the maintainers cherrypicking and merging squashes.
  • If the PR is related to any front end change, please attach relevant screenshots in the pull request description.
  • Please follow the guides and code standards: Swift Style Guide
  • Please follow the good iOS development practices: iOS Good Practices

License

This project is currently licensed under the MIT. A copy of LICENSE should be present along with the source code.

phimpme-ios's People

Contributors

jogendra avatar

Watchers

 avatar  av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.